A prototype bolt shaft (assume a uniform cylinder) that is to be loaded in tension is made of a stainless steel with a yield strength of 450 MPa and has a safety factor of 3 with respect to yielding for the maximum allowable loading. Find two ductile materials that could be used to replace the steel to make the bolt lighter while maintaining the same safety factor. The new bolts will have the same length as the original but may have different diameters. What is the percent weight savings with each of the new materials? What other material properties might be important to consider before a final choice is made?
